Definitely too far gone to remember anything other than jokes about Kippers or Tories scrawled on toilet walls. I think I mostly just stare into the abyss.

If I’m honest, I can’t see how it’d be effective anyway unless it was advertising something happening on site. Everyone is surrounded by musical attractions throughout the weekend so checking those out properly trumps seeking out an act based on a name on a flyer on a toilet door.
